What is the house edge on live roulette?
For European roulette (single zero), the house edge is 2.7%. For American roulette (double zero), it jumps to 5.26%. Always choose the European variant. It gives you a better mathematical chance.

Understanding the Fine Print on Bonuses
Bonuses look amazing on the surface. But you need to read the terms. A standard welcome package at a live roulette online UK 2026 real money site might look like this:
- Offer: 100% match bonus up to £200 + 50 free spins on a slot game.
- Wagering Requirement: 35x the bonus amount. So if you get a £100 bonus, you must wager £3,500 before you can withdraw any winnings from that bonus.
- Time Limit: You usually have 30 days to complete the wagering.
- Game Contribution: Live roulette often contributes only 10% or 20% towards wagering requirements. Slots usually contribute 100%. This is a critical detail.
- Max Bet: You cannot bet more than £5 per spin while the bonus is active. Exceeding this voids the bonus.
- Max Cashout: Some bonuses cap your winnings. For example, ‘Max cashout from bonus is £150’.
My advice? If you want to play live roulette, it is often better to skip the welcome bonus and just play with your cash deposit. The wagering requirements on table games make bonuses less valuable than they seem. You are better off using the cash to play directly. Responsible Gambling and Setting Limits
I have been doing this for a long time. The most important tool you have is the deposit limit. Before you even open a game, go to your account settings. Set a daily, weekly, or monthly deposit limit. I set mine to £50 per day. This stops me from chasing losses.
All UKGC licensed sites have a ‘Reality Check’ feature. It pops up every hour to remind you how long you have been playing. Use it. It is easy to lose track of time when the stream is so immersive.
If you ever feel like you are losing control, most sites have a self-exclusion option. You can ban yourself for 6 months, a year, or permanently. Do not be ashamed to use it. The game will be here when you come back.
